#583d7c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#583d7c is composed of 34.5% red, 23.9%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29% cyan, 50.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 265.7 degrees, a saturation of 34.1% and a lightness of 36.3%. #583d7c color hex could be obtained by blending #b07af8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#583d7c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040306 is the darkest color, while #f9f8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#583d7c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5960 is the less saturated color, while #5004b5 is the most saturated one.
